Responsibilities:
- Take ownership of Salesforce support items, providing second-level and advanced support for issues involving automation, integration with SAP and other systems, validation, configuration, and custom coding (APEX, Lightning Web Components).
- Act as a technical mentor for other members of the team, supporting onboarding and continuous skills development for junior colleagues.
- Collaborate with international business and IT partners, architects, and global team members to define and deliver scalable, sustainable Salesforce solutions.
- Perform root cause analysis, identify trends, and implement process optimizations or technical improvements for recurring issues.
- Help design and maintain robust data models and oversee process documentation within the Salesforce landscape.
- Stay up-to-date with new Salesforce features and industry best practices, advocating for improvements to our global technology stack.

Requirements:
- University degree in Computer Science, Business Informatics, Information Systems, Digital Media, or comparable field.
- Salesforce Administrator certification required; advanced certifications (e.g., Platform Developer, Architect) highly preferred.
- Minimum 3 years of experience supporting and developing in Salesforce, with proven skills in automation, validation, configuration, integration, and hands-on coding (APEX, Lightning Components).
- Strong mentoring, interpersonal, and communication abilities; experience in a multinational team is a plus.
-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ills, with a strong customer service mindset.
- Fluent in English (spoken and written).
- Familiarity with IT Service Management (ITIL) and agile project methods (Scrum) is beneficial.

Looking to make your move? Then you’ve come to the right place! We are the KION Group, and the world of intralogistics is our home. Our solutions ensure the smooth flow of materials and information in production plants, warehouses, and distribution centers in over 100 countries.
We have around 41,000 employees who make a real difference, helping us to become who we are today: the biggest manufacturer of forklift trucks and warehouse handling equipment in Europe, and one of the world’s leading warehouse automation providers.

Who makes up the KION Group? With our international brands Linde Material Handling, STILL, and Baoli, as well as regional brands Fenwick and OM, we stand for exceptional technology and service expertise for forklift trucks and warehouse handling equipment around the world. Dematic expands the portfolio with its automated material handling solutions for intralogistics processes in warehouses, production, and sales
